- TransCanada (TRP) says it has re-filed its application to route its Keystone XL pipeline through Nebraska, where it has faced some opposition from environmentalists and landowners concerned about oil spills.
- "The (Nebraska Public Service Commission) process is the clearest path to achieving route certainty for the project in Nebraska and is expected to conclude in 2017," the company says.
- Shares are little changed even after the company's Q4 results came in above expectations and the quarterly dividend was raised 11% to C$0.625.
